William Blair Investment Management LLC bought a new position in shares of Royal Bank of Canada (NYSE:RY - Free Report) TSE: RY in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The institutional investor bought 584,867 shares of the financial services provider's stock, valued at approximately $70,429,000.

Other hedge funds and other institutional investors have also recently made changes to their positions in the company. OneDigital Investment Advisors LLC boosted its holdings in Royal Bank of Canada by 4.8% in the 3rd quarter. OneDigital Investment Advisors LLC now owns 2,508 shares of the financial services provider's stock worth $313,000 after buying an additional 115 shares during the last quarter. Coastline Trust Co purchased a new stake in shares of Royal Bank of Canada during the third quarter worth approximately $41,000. Natixis Advisors LLC raised its stake in Royal Bank of Canada by 3.9% in the 3rd quarter. Natixis Advisors LLC now owns 122,223 shares of the financial services provider's stock valued at $15,245,000 after purchasing an additional 4,615 shares during the last quarter. Prudent Man Advisors LLC purchased a new position in Royal Bank of Canada in the 3rd quarter valued at $220,000. Finally, Drive Wealth Management LLC boosted its stake in Royal Bank of Canada by 3.4% during the 3rd quarter. Drive Wealth Management LLC now owns 2,799 shares of the financial services provider's stock worth $349,000 after purchasing an additional 92 shares during the last quarter. Hedge funds and other institutional investors own 45.31% of the company's stock.

Royal Bank of Canada Trading Down 0.1 %

Shares of Royal Bank of Canada stock traded down $0.11 during mid-day trading on Friday, hitting $113.71. The stock had a trading volume of 758,358 shares, compared to its average volume of 1,240,402. The firm has a 50-day moving average of $117.95 and a two-hundred day moving average of $121.33. The firm has a market cap of $160.52 billion, a P/E ratio of 13.77,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.80 and a beta of 0.88. The company has a quick ratio of 0.86, a current ratio of 0.86 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.11. Royal Bank of Canada has a 12-month low of $95.84 and a 12-month high of $128.05.

Royal Bank of Canada Cuts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, May 23rd. Investors of record on Thursday, April 24th will be issued a $1.0251 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, April 24th. This represents a $4.10 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.61%. Royal Bank of Canada's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 45.96%.

Analyst Ratings Changes

RY has been the topic of several research reports. Barclays raised shares of Royal Bank of Canada from an "equal weight" rating to an "overweight" rating in a research note on Thursday, November 21st. CIBC reissued a "neutral" rating on shares of Royal Bank of Canada in a research note on Wednesday, March 5th. BMO Capital Markets dropped their price target on Royal Bank of Canada from $195.00 to $193.00 and set an "outperform" rating for the company in a research report on Thursday, December 5th. Finally, StockNews.com raised Royal Bank of Canada from a "sell" rating to a "hold" rating in a report on Friday, February 28th. Three equities research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, five have given a buy rating and one has issued a strong buy r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at.com, Royal Bank of Canada currently has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and an average target price of $156.50.

About Royal Bank of Canada

(Free Report)

Royal Bank of Canada operates as a diversified financial service company worldwide. The company's Personal & Commercial Banking segment offers checking and savings accounts, home equity financing, personal lending, private banking, indirect lending, including auto financing, mutual funds and self-directed brokerage accounts, guaranteed investment certificates, credit cards, and payment products and solutions; and lending, leasing, deposit, investment, foreign exchange, cash management, auto dealer financing, trade products, and services to small and medium-sized commercial businesses.
